Remarkable people, trusted by clients to design and advance the world.  Wood have an exciting opportunity for a Senior Planner to join our team on a fixed term basis for 12 months. This position is based at our Clients offices in Ware, Hertfordshire and we are open to both fixed term staff and PSC applicants. The Role You will prepare, review and report accurate project schedules and plans in support of the robust control of projects throughout their life cycle. Preparation and submission of project schedules and plans, ensuring schedules and plans are prepared to the required level of detail and accuracy in accordance with contractual requirements and Wood policies, procedures, and standards. Supporting the management and development of the Planning team, the management of project schedules and plans, and the preparation and filing of project planning documentation. As a Senior Planner, you may act as the focal point for several project scopes. Designing the future. Transforming the world. Why join Process & Energy? The P&E part of the business, which sits in the Operations part of the business can offer a wide range of opportunities which will allow you to develop your skills across a portfolio of onshore projects in different sectors. Our current portfolio includes green hydrogen and fuel switching, as well as supporting local clients with energy transition.  Additionally, we work on UK refineries, petrochemical facilities, fine chemicals and pharmaceutical facilities. We have a number of clients who we are working with to design their pilot plants to test exciting new technologies, with a view to partnering with them as they move to design and build full scale commercial facilities.   We have some of the best engineers in the UK, and we have high expectations on the performance of the project teams.
